设计模式
nobody_lo
这个作者很懒,什么都没留下…
展开
-
设计模式之适配器模式
适配器就是一种适配中间件,它存在于不匹配的二者之间,用于连接二者,将不匹配变得匹配,简单点理解就是平常所见的转接头,转换器之类的存在。 适配器模式有两种:类适配器、对象适配器、接口适配器 前二者在实现上有些许区别,作用一样,第三个接口适配器差别较大。 直接上代码: 父接口SuperA和SuperB: package com.my.proxyDemo; public interface Super...原创 2019-01-17 22:06:11 · 84 阅读 · 0 评论 -
设计模式之观察者模式
观察者模式例子: 1、一个被观察者接口Observed,有添加add、删除del、通知notify观察者的方法 2、一个具体被观察的类ObservedImpl,实现1中的被观察者接口Observed,,有一个属性pro,这个属性发生改变时调用通知观察者的方法notify 3、观察者接口Observer,有一个更新信息的方法updateInfo,需要传入被观察类ObservedConcrete的属性...原创 2019-01-19 00:58:14 · 77 阅读 · 0 评论